What Are the Different Types of Lawn Mower Blades?
The different types of lawn mower blades cater to various cutting needs and grass types.
- Standard Blades: These are the most common blades found in residential mowers, designed for general grass cutting. They provide a clean cut and are suitable for most types of lawns, making them versatile and easy to maintain.
- Mulching Blades: Mulching blades are designed with curved edges that chop grass into finer pieces, allowing them to decompose and fertilize the lawn. They can help reduce the need for bagging clippings, promoting a healthier lawn by returning nutrients to the soil.
- High-Lift Blades: High-lift blades feature a special design that creates a stronger airflow, helping to lift grass clippings and discharge them efficiently into a bag. These blades are ideal for tall and dense grass, as they effectively prevent clogging during mowing.
- Low-Lift Blades: Low-lift blades are designed for cutting grass that is short and not overly thick, minimizing suction and making them suitable for flat, dry lawns. They produce less lift and are often used in areas where bagging is less important.
- Gator Blades: Gator blades combine features of standard and mulching blades and have a unique design that allows for both excellent cutting and effective mulching. They are ideal for homeowners looking for a dual-purpose solution, providing a clean cut while returning nutrients to the soil.
- Reel Blades: These are used in reel mowers and consist of a series of blades rotating against a stationary bed knife. This design allows for a precise and scissor-like cut, making them perfect for maintaining a well-manicured lawn, particularly in fine turf environments.

How Do Mulching Blades Benefit Your Lawn?
Mulching blades provide several benefits for maintaining a healthy lawn.
- Enhanced Nutrient Recycling: Mulching blades finely chop grass clippings, allowing them to decompose more quickly. This process returns essential nutrients back to the soil, promoting healthier grass growth without the need for chemical fertilizers.
- Improved Lawn Health: By keeping the clippings on the lawn, mulching blades help retain moisture in the soil. This moisture retention can reduce the frequency of watering, particularly during dry spells, ensuring that the grass remains vibrant and healthy.
- Reduced Waste: Using mulching blades eliminates the need for bagging grass clippings and disposing of them. This not only saves time and effort but also helps reduce landfill waste, making it an environmentally friendly option.
- Enhanced Turf Quality: The fine particles produced by mulching blades settle on the grass, providing a natural layer of mulch. This layer can help suppress weeds and protect the soil from extreme temperatures, contributing to a more robust turf quality throughout the growing season.
- Cost-Effective Lawn Care: Since mulching blades help recycle nutrients and reduce the need for additional fertilizers, they can lead to lower overall lawn care costs. Homeowners can maintain a lush lawn while minimizing their spending on lawn maintenance products.
What Advantages Do High-Lift Blades Offer?
High-lift blades offer several advantages for lawn mowing and maintenance.
- Improved Grass Discharge: High-lift blades are designed with a unique shape that allows for better airflow, which helps in efficiently discharging clippings from the mower deck. This feature is particularly beneficial for those who prefer a clean-cut lawn without leaving clumps of grass behind.
- Enhanced Mulching Capability: While primarily designed for discharge, high-lift blades can also assist in mulching by lifting the grass more effectively, allowing it to be chopped into finer pieces. This can help return nutrients to the soil, promoting healthier lawn growth.
- Better Performance in Wet Conditions: High-lift blades are ideal for mowing in wet conditions as they prevent clogging by facilitating the removal of wet clippings. This ensures a smooth mowing experience, reducing the chances of the mower stalling due to accumulated grass.
- Versatility: These blades can be used on various lawn types and conditions, from thick and lush grass to more sparse lawns. Their design allows them to handle different mowing tasks efficiently, making them a versatile choice for homeowners.
- Reduced Strain on Mower Engine: By efficiently lifting and discharging clippings, high-lift blades can reduce the load on the mower’s engine. This can lead to better fuel efficiency and less wear on the engine over time, prolonging the life of the mower.

What Factors Should You Consider When Selecting Lawn Mower Blades?
When selecting the best blades for a lawn mower, several important factors must be considered to ensure optimal performance and lawn health.
- Blade Type: Different types of blades are designed for specific mowing tasks, such as standard, mulching, or side discharge. Standard blades are ideal for regular mowing, while mulching blades chop grass finely to return nutrients to the soil, and side discharge blades are designed to efficiently expel clippings to the side.
- Material: The material of the blades affects their durability and cutting performance. High-carbon steel blades are common for their balance of sharpness and strength, while stainless steel blades resist rust and corrosion, leading to a longer lifespan.
- Length and Thickness: The length and thickness of the blades can influence cutting efficiency and mower compatibility. Longer blades may cover more ground but require more power, while thicker blades provide sturdiness and are less prone to bending or breaking during use.
- Compatibility: Ensuring the blades are compatible with your specific lawn mower model is crucial for performance and safety. Each mower has unique specifications, including bolt patterns and sizes, so it’s essential to check the manufacturer’s recommendations before purchasing new blades.
- Cutting Height: The ability to adjust the cutting height is important for maintaining the health of your lawn. Different blade designs may influence how low or high you can mow, which is vital for preventing scalping and promoting healthy grass growth.
- Sharpening and Maintenance: Consider how easy it is to sharpen and maintain the blades. Blades that retain sharpness longer or are designed for easy sharpening will save time and effort, ensuring consistent cutting performance throughout the mowing season.

What Are the Best Maintenance Practices for Lawn Mower Blades?
The best maintenance practices for lawn mower blades ensure optimal performance and longevity.
- Regular Sharpening: Keeping the blades sharp is crucial for a clean cut. Dull blades tear the grass rather than cutting it, leading to a ragged appearance and increasing the risk of disease.
- Cleaning After Use: Cleaning the blades after each mowing session prevents grass clippings and debris from building up. This not only maintains blade efficiency but also reduces the risk of rust and corrosion.
- Inspection for Damage: Regularly inspecting blades for nicks, cracks, or bends is essential. Damaged blades can affect the mower’s performance and lead to uneven cutting or further damage to the mower.
- Proper Storage: Storing the mower in a dry, sheltered area helps protect the blades from moisture and rust. Covering the mower or using a tarp can also prevent debris from accumulating on the blades during storage.
- Balancing the Blades: Ensuring that the blades are properly balanced helps prevent vibrations during operation, which can lead to wear and tear on the mower. Unbalanced blades can also affect the quality of the cut.
- Replacing Worn Blades: Over time, blades will wear out and need replacement. Using the best blades for lawn mowers suited for your specific model can improve efficiency and cutting performance.
How Can You Properly Sharpen Lawn Mower Blades?
To properly sharpen lawn mower blades, you can follow these essential steps:
- Gather Necessary Tools: Ensure you have the right tools such as a wrench, a blade sharpener or file, and safety gear like gloves and goggles.
- Remove the Blade: Safely remove the lawn mower blade by disconnecting the spark plug and using a wrench to unscrew the blade from the mower.
- Clean the Blade: Before sharpening, clean the blade thoroughly to remove grass clippings and debris, which helps you see the edge better and ensures an even sharpening.
- Sharpen the Blade: Use a blade sharpener or a metal file to sharpen the cutting edge, maintaining the original angle for effective cutting performance.
- Balance the Blade: After sharpening, it’s crucial to balance the blade by checking that both sides weigh the same, which prevents vibration and ensures smooth operation.
- Reattach the Blade: Carefully reattach the blade to the mower, ensuring it is secured tightly, and reconnect the spark plug before testing the mower.
Gathering necessary tools is crucial as it not only ensures you have everything at hand but also promotes safety during the sharpening process. Using a wrench to securely remove the blade is important since a loose blade can lead to accidents or improper cuts.
Cleaning the blade removes built-up grass and debris, allowing you to inspect for any damages and providing a clean surface to sharpen. This step is often overlooked but significantly enhances the sharpening process.
When sharpening, it’s vital to keep the original angle of the blade, typically around 30 degrees, to maintain its cutting efficiency. Using a blade sharpener designed for lawn mower blades can yield the best results, as it is specifically made to handle the metal used.
Balancing the blade is a critical step because an unbalanced blade can lead to excessive vibration, damaging your mower and reducing its lifespan. A simple way to test balance is to place the blade on a nail or a similar object; if it tilts to one side, further adjustments are needed.
Finally, reattaching the blade should be done with care, ensuring that all fasteners are tight and secure to avoid any operational issues when the mower is used again. Following these steps will help maintain the best performance of your lawn mower blades.
What Steps Can Be Taken to Prevent Rust and Corrosion?
To prevent rust and corrosion on lawn mower blades, several proactive measures can be taken:
- Regular Cleaning: Keeping blades clean by removing grass clippings, dirt, and debris after each use helps prevent moisture accumulation that can lead to rust.
- Proper Storage: Storing the lawn mower in a dry, sheltered location, preferably indoors or under a cover, can protect it from rain and humidity.
- Oil Coating: Applying a thin layer of oil on the blades can create a protective barrier against moisture and oxidation, significantly reducing the chances of corrosion.
- Use of Rust Inhibitors: Using commercial rust inhibitors or sprays specifically designed for metal surfaces can provide added protection against rust formation on blades.
- Routine Maintenance: Regularly inspecting and maintaining the mower, including sharpening the blades and checking for any signs of wear or damage, can help identify and address potential rust issues early.

How Do You Identify Common Issues with Lawn Mower Blades?
Identifying common issues with lawn mower blades is essential for maintaining optimal performance and achieving the best cut. The following are key aspects to consider:
- Dull Blades: Dull blades can lead to uneven cuts and ragged grass edges, which may make your lawn appear unhealthy. Regularly inspecting and sharpening blades can prevent this issue and improve the overall health of your grass.
- Damage and Nicks: Blades can become damaged or develop nicks due to hitting rocks or debris during mowing. Such imperfections can affect the cutting efficiency and require either sharpening or replacement of the blades to ensure a clean cut.
- Corrosion: Rust and corrosion can weaken blades and reduce their effectiveness. Keeping blades clean and storing the mower in a dry place can help prevent corrosion, prolonging the lifespan of the blades.
- Improper Blade Height: The height at which blades are set can affect cut quality and lawn health. If the blades are set too low, they can scalp the lawn, while too high can lead to uncut patches; adjusting the blade height according to grass type and season is crucial.
- Incorrect Blade Type: Using the wrong type of blade for your specific lawn mower or grass type can lead to poor cutting performance. It’s important to choose blades designed for your mower’s model and the specific needs of your grass for the best results.

How Do Dull Blades Impact Lawn Health and Aesthetics?
Dull blades can significantly affect both the health and aesthetics of a lawn.
- Uneven Cuts: Dull blades tend to tear rather than cut grass, leading to jagged edges. This uneven cutting not only makes the lawn look unkempt but can also stress the grass, making it more susceptible to diseases.
- Increased Risk of Disease: When grass blades are torn, they expose more surface area to pathogens and pests. This can result in higher instances of lawn diseases, as the damaged tissue provides an entry point for fungi and bacteria.
- Reduced Photosynthesis: Dull blades fail to provide clean cuts, which can hinder the grass’s ability to photosynthesize effectively. The torn blades may reduce the overall health of the grass, leading to poor growth and a lack of vigor.
- Higher Mowing Frequency: Mowing with dull blades can create a rougher surface, leading to a need for more frequent mowing. This not only increases the time and effort required for lawn maintenance but can also contribute to soil compaction and tire damage from repeated passes.
- Increased Thatch Buildup: The stress from uneven cuts can lead to excessive thatch accumulation, which is a layer of dead grass and roots. This layer can suffocate the grass beneath it, leading to further deterioration of lawn health.
